About Converting Decigrams per Gallon to Decagrams per Cubic Meter
Decigram per Gallon and Decagram per Cubic Meter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
decagrams per cubic meter = decigrams per gallon × 2.64172052358
This factor comes from each unit's defined relationship to the category's base unit: 1 decigram per gallon equals 0.0264172052358 base units, and 1 decagram per cubic meter equals 0.01 base units, so dividing one by the other gives the direct decigram per gallon-to-decagram per cubic meter factor of 2.64172052358.
Simple example
1 dg/gal × 2.641720524 = 2.641720524 dag/m3
1 decigram per gallon = 2.641720524 decagrams per cubic meter.
Real-world example
1,000 dg/gal × 2.641720524 = 2,641.720524 dag/m3
1,000 decigrams per gallon = 2,641.720524 decagrams per cubic meter.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
